NY Fed: Manufacturing Activity "improved modestly" in April

Catching up: This was released earlier from the NY Fed: April's Empire State Manufacturing Survey indicates manufacturing activity in New York State improved modestly April’s Empire State Manufacturing Survey indicates that manufacturing activity in New York State improved modestly. Although the general business conditions index fell fourteen points, it remained positive at 6.6. The new orders and shipments indexes also remained positive, but showed only a small increase in orders and shipments.

Apple's P/E, Price Target Spread

With Apple down nearly 8% from its recent high, below is an updated chart of its forward 12-month P/E ratio.  As shown, up until the last couple of months, Apple's forward P/E had actually been falling even as its price climbed steadily higher.  Once the stock went parabolic at the start of the year, however, it finally saw some P/E expansion.  Since its share price peaked last week, Apple's forward P/E has fallen from 14.25 down to 13.11.
